Workshop at Art`s Complex in September


Over 6 days of the Workshop we will provide you with all possible information, guidance and assistance you need to complete the Icon of Christ Pantocrator. You will have a choice of a few different images.

We relay on an ancient images.

“the best teachers are the ancient icons” 
Leonid Ouspensky (1902-1987)




We will explain all principles of egg tempera and gold gilding you need to know to paint your first icon. Although we will be taking you through all stages of the process as you never made an icon before all advanced students are welcome as well.

We would like to show you not only all aspects of technique itself. We think it`s very important to learn the tradition and try to understand how Iconography has been growing in the Orthodox tradition. There will be a short introduction.

We hope that our Workshop will be just a beginning of a fascinating journey you will take.


We provide

Because we would like you to experience the icon painting in it`s best quality we provide all materials you need on our Workshop. This will include:
gesso panel,
set of dry pigments,
egg yolk, wine,
3 squirrel brushes,
                                       schlagmetal and everything you need for gilding,
                                       pencil, paper etc.

                                    We will show you the oldest Varnish called Olifa and how to apply it.
